4.2 Adding the salt
The amount of scale contained in the water
(water hardness index) can cause whitish
staining on the dry dishes, which tend to
become dull over time. The dishwasher is
equipped with an automatic softening
system which uses a special regenerating
salt to reduce the hardness of the water.
When using water of medium hardness, the regenerating salt container
should be refilled after approximately 20 washing cycles. The salt
container can hold approximately 1 kg of salt in grains. Some models are
equipped with an optical no-salt indicator. In these models, the cap of the
salt container contains a green float which descends as the salt
concentration in the water drops. When the green float can no longer be
seen through the transparent cap, the container must be topped up with
regenerating salt. The container is situated at the bottom of the
dishwasher.
The salt prevents the formation of scale
deposits.
Remove the lower basket.
Unscrew the cap of the salt container by
turning it anticlockwise.
When using the dishwasher for the first time, fill the container with a
litre of water.
Pour salt (approx. 1 kg) into the container using the funnel provided
with the dishwasher.
When finished, remove any salt residues before screwing the cap
back on.
